Josh Hall and Christina Haack are officially divorced, and he marked the occasion with some scathing words to his ex.

“Excited to spend Labor Day weekend in the real reality… Finally, legally divorced and a free man. I’ve always worked hard, kept what’s mine, and declined hand outs, and I’m keeping it that way,” Hall, 44, wrote alongside a photo of himself next to a saddled horse shared via Instagram on Thursday, August 28. “Lesson learned: don’t marry someone who needs constant public validation and will use your personal drama for attention.”

The post comes days after their divorce was finalized in a shocking settlement on Tuesday, August 26. Haack, 42, paid the Texas real estate agent $300,000 on May 6, along with $40,000 for his legal fees, according to legal documents obtained by E! News. The judgment also noted a previous unallocated lump-sum payment of $100,000 that she made to the 44-year-old in September 2024.

Hall was the first to officially file for divorce on July 15, 2024, citing “irreconcilable differences, and Haack followed with a filing of her own just hours later. She noted their official separation date as July 8, 2024, and the drama quickly ramped up between the two exes.

The HGTV star listed their $4.5 million Tennessee farmhouse, which she had owned before the two married, but Hall quickly pumped the brakes and filed an emergency order to halt the sale, arguing that mortgage payments made during their marriage gave him a say in the property’s fate. She then accused Hall of financial misconduct and claimed that he transferred over $35,000 into his bank account from hers without her knowledge. Hall denied the claims and said that the money was used for shared property expenses.

Both parties took shots at one another on social media, and after a 12-hour mediation session in May, a settlement was signed off by a judge who granted neither party any spousal support.
